An educational platform uses the DHUMA API to create an AI avatar of a passionate conservationist who acts as a guide for virtual field trips. The API's expressive capabilities allow the avatar to convey a sense of wonder when describing a beautiful coral reef and urgency when discussing threats like pollution. The avatar can use hand gestures to point out specific species in 360-degree video environments, creating an immersive and emotionally resonant learning experience.

Industry Challenge

Interactive Guide for Virtual Field Trips

The education sector continually seeks innovative methods to engage students and make learning more impactful. Traditional resources for subjects like environmental science often fall short, presenting information in a dry, unrelatable manner. This disconnection is particularly acute when teaching about remote or endangered ecosystems, where students lack a tangible connection to the subject matter. The challenge lies in creating immersive and emotionally resonant experiences that not only educate but also inspire a sense of urgency and a passion for conservation.

The DHUMA Solution

The DHUMA AI Avatar Platform provides a powerful solution by enabling the creation of interactive and emotionally intelligent AI guides for virtual field trips. By leveraging the DHUMA API, educational platforms can develop AI avatars that embody the passion and expertise of a seasoned conservationist. These avatars guide students through immersive 360-degree video environments, using expressive gestures and vocal tones to bring the learning experience to life. The API's ability to convey nuanced emotions allows the avatar to express wonder when showcasing the beauty of a coral reef and urgency when discussing the threats it faces, creating a deeply engaging and memorable educational journey.
